Turkish cardamom, also known as green cardamom or true cardamom, is a prized spice that is native to the lush forests of southwest India. It is derived from the dried seeds of the Elettaria cardamomum plant and has been used for centuries in culinary and medicinal applications. The spice trade brought cardamom to the shores of Turkey, where it became widely cultivated and prized for its intense flavor and fragrance. Turkish cardamom is known for its vibrant green color, robust aroma, and rich flavor profile that combines spicy, citrusy, and herbal notes.

When it comes to perfumery, Turkish cardamom adds a touch of exotic allure and sophistication to a fragrance composition. Its warm and spicy aroma instantly evokes images of bustling bazaars, exotic spices, and ancient rituals. The scent of Turkish cardamom is complex and multi-faceted, with nuances of citrus, eucalyptus, and pine that create a sense of depth and mystery. In a fragrance, Turkish cardamom can act as a top, middle, or base note, depending on the desired effect.

As a top note, Turkish cardamom imparts a fresh and zesty opening that grabs the attention of the wearer. Its bright and invigorating aroma sets the tone for the rest of the fragrance and creates a sense of anticipation. When combined with other citrusy notes such as bergamot or lemon, Turkish cardamom adds an extra dimension of complexity and depth. The spicy and aromatic qualities of cardamom linger on the skin, leaving a trail of warmth and sensuality.

When used as a middle note, Turkish cardamom adds a warm and spicy heart to a fragrance that is both comforting and invigorating. Its rich and aromatic aroma blends beautifully with floral notes such as rose, jasmine, or neroli, creating a harmonious bouquet that is both feminine and exotic. Turkish cardamom injects a sense of passion and sensuality into the heart of a fragrance, enveloping the wearer in a cloud of warmth and mystery.

As a base note, Turkish cardamom provides a lasting and grounding presence that anchors the entire fragrance composition. Its deep and spicy aroma lingers on the skin for hours, exuding a sense of luxury and sophistication. When combined with woody notes such as sandalwood, cedarwood, or vetiver, Turkish cardamom adds a warm and earthy quality that is both elegant and refined. The scent of cardamom becomes intertwined with the skin, creating a unique and intimate olfactory experience.
